The creation of the Internet of Things (IoT) has reworked various sectors, promising enhanced effectivity and connectivity. However, the potential of IoT in rural areas faces important hurdles as a outcome of connectivity points. Despite the vast benefits that IoT can provide, together with automated farming, telemedicine, and smart house solutions, the reality is that many rural areas are still struggling with insufficient connectivity.


Many rural areas lack the necessary infrastructure to assist reliable internet connections. Traditional broadband companies are sometimes limited or non-existent in these regions, resulting in a reliance on satellite tv for pc or mobile networks, which will not be strong enough to deal with excessive data traffic. The distance from urban centers usually interprets to higher prices for providers, leading to fewer funding incentives in these areas.


The demands of IoT gadgets require a constant and stable web connection to perform optimally. Without this, gadgets send and obtain knowledge intermittently, leading to poor efficiency and unreliable readings. For agricultural IoT purposes, this could imply malfunctioning sensors that fail to provide correct data on soil situations, moisture levels, or crop health, in the end affecting farm productivity.


Moreover, community congestion is another important problem. In rural areas with low population density, suppliers may provide limited bandwidth because of the fewer number of users. As more gadgets hook up with the network, speeds can plummet, making it difficult for IoT systems that rely upon real-time knowledge change. This becomes particularly critical in purposes corresponding to remote healthcare, the place timely knowledge transmission is usually a matter of life and demise.

The lack of advanced telecommunications infrastructure usually results in high latency points in rural areas. Latency is the time it takes for knowledge to travel from the supply to the destination and back. High latency can render IoT techniques ineffective, notably in applications requiring instant feedback, such as remote monitoring of medical sufferers. When knowledge takes too long to course of, crucial information could additionally be delayed, compromising the effectiveness of interventions.


Another aspect to suppose about is the varying levels of technology literacy amongst rural populations. While some communities may embrace IoT technologies, others might view them with suspicion or lack the talents to make the most of them effectively. This digital divide additional exacerbates the connectivity issues. Community schooling and training packages could promote broader understanding and acceptance of IoT methods, however their implementation requires sources that are typically lacking in rural areas - Remote Iot Monitoring Solution.


Security considerations additionally complicate the deployment of IoT technologies. Many rural areas aren't well-equipped to deal with the cybersecurity threats that IoT units can encounter. Weak network security can result in unauthorized access, knowledge breaches, and even manipulation of linked devices. This concern might deter both potential users and investors from partaking with IoT options in rural settings.


The geographical challenges faced in rural regions impression the deployment of IoT infrastructure. Remote Monitoring Using Iot. Dense forests, mountains, and other geographical options can obstruct alerts and decrease the standard of connectivity, making it tough for devices to communicate successfully. Although developments like mesh networks are promising, implementing them in sparsely populated areas can be inefficient and dear.
